The April Janesville City Council election is heating up with one of the incumbents filing a declaration of non-candidacy.

After three terms on the Janesville City Council, president Paul Benson announces he’s not seeking re-election.

Benson says he’s proud of the work that got done during his tenure, including adding hundreds of housing units, development of the south side industrial park, and the hiring of City Manager Kevin Lahner.

The list of candidates who’ve signaled they intend to run includes newcomers Larry Squire, Josh Erdman, Mathew Gonzalez and Billy McCoy; along with incumbents Aaron Burdick and Paul Williams.

There are three open seats on the Janesville City Council.
